#c69f37 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c69f37 is composed of 77.6% red, 62.4%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.7% magenta, 72.2%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 43.6 degrees, a saturation of 56.5% and a lightness of 49.6%. #c69f37 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6e with #8d3f00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

Shades and Tints of #c69f37

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0b04 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.
